Geological Oceanography (Hons)
Like its BSc counterpart, this four year Geological Oceanography (Hons) Degree at Bangor University focuses on the study of marine sediments within an Earth system science context. You will learn about sedimentary processes the origin, transport and deposition of particles in the marine environment, and marine sediments and rocks, in particular those formed in the past 2 million years.
